Orosil Smiths disclosed that promoter group entity B K Narula HUF acquired 48,704 equity shares in the open market on September 3, 2026. The transaction was reported under Regulation 29(2) of the SEBI (Substantial Acquisition of Shares and Takeovers) Regulations, 2011.

The acquisition increased the promoter's stake from 15.64% to 15.76% of the company's total paid-up equity share capital. Prior to this purchase, B K Narula HUF held 6,463,451 shares carrying voting rights.

Promoter group entity B K Narula HUF acquired 1,264 equity shares of Orosil Smiths India Limited through the open market on August 26, 2026.

The acquisition was disclosed under Regulation 29(2) of the SEBI (Substantial Acquisition of Shares and Takeovers) Regulations, 2011. The transaction did not alter the promoter's overall voting power, which remains at 15.64% of the total paid-up equity share capital.

Holding Details

Prior to the transaction, B K Narula HUF held 64,62,187 shares carrying voting rights. Following the purchase, the total holding increased to 64,63,451 shares. None of the shares held by the acquirer are encumbered by pledge, lien, or non-disposal undertakings.
